The Arizona Renaissance Festival runs every Saturday and Sunday, Feb. 8  through March 29, from 10 a.m. to 6 p.m. Cheer for brave knights! Roam our 30-acre festival village filled with whimsical castles, cottages, pubs and 14 stages of nonstop performances of music, mermaids, merriment, dance, acrobatics, and comedy.

Advance tickets 

Save time when tickets are purchased on-line at RenFestInfo.com, or save with discount tickets purchased at Fry’s Food stores statewide. Discount ticket prices are Adult for $26, and children 5-12 $16 when purchased at Fry’s Food stores, children under 5 are always free. Tickets purchased at the Festival are two dollars more. Senior discount tickets are $25 for those 60 and older, available only on festival days at the front gate ticket booth. Parking is free courtesy of Fry’s Food stores. 

The Renaissance Festival site is located east of Apache Junction on U.S. Highway 60, just past Gold Canyon Golf Resort. (12601 East US Hwy 60) For visitor information, call 520 – 463 – 2700 or visit RenFestInfo.com. Huzzah!
